ADT (NYSE:ADT - Get Free Report) was downgraded by Wall Street Zen from a "strong-buy" rating to a "buy" rating in a research note issued on Saturday.
Other analysts have also recently issued reports about the company. Royal Bank Of Canada restated a "sector perform" rating and issued a $9.00 price target on shares of ADT in a research note on Monday, April 21st. Barclays raised ADT from an "underweight" rating to an "equal weight" rating and raised their target price for the stock from $7.00 to $9.00 in a research report on Friday, April 4th. Finally, Morgan Stanley upped their price target on ADT from $9.00 to $9.50 and gave the company an "equal weight" rating in a report on Monday, July 28th. Three anal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and two have assigned a bu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at, the company currently has a consensus rating of "Hold" and an average price target of $9.18.

ADT Price Performance
ADT stock opened at $8.30 on Friday. The business's fifty day moving average price is $8.37 and its 200 day moving average price is $8.00. ADT has a 12-month low of $6.53 and a 12-month high of $8.80. The company has a current ratio of 0.46, a quick ratio of 0.37 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.84. The company has a market capitalization of $6.90 billion, a PE ratio of 12.58 and a beta of 1.20.
ADT (NYSE:ADT -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 24th. The security and automation business reported $0.23 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.19 by $0.04. The company had revenue of $1.29 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.28 billion. ADT had a net margin of 12.30% and a return on equity of 18.58%. The firm's revenue was up 6.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$0.17 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that ADT will post 0.7 EPS for the current year.
Insider Buying and Selling at ADT
In other news, major shareholder Apollo Management Holdings Gp, sold 71,000,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ction on Monday, July 28th. The stock was sold at an average price of $8.31, for a total value of $590,010,000.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the insider owned 112,650,366 shares in the company, valued at $936,124,541.46. This trade represents a 38.66%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available through the SEC website. In the last 90 days, insiders sold 166,000,000 shares of company stock valued at $1,363,160,000. Corporate insiders own 2.70% of the company's stock.

ADT Inc provides security, interactive, and smart home solutions to residential and small business customers in the United States. It operates through two segments, Consumer and Small Business, and Solar. The company provides burglar and life safety alarms, smart security cameras, smart home automation systems, and video surveillance systems.
